Knowing is only the first step: strategies to support the development of scientific understanding
Issue 369 | Page 116 | Published Jun 2018
Description
Models of scientific understanding are examined, leading to the claim that knowledge acquisition is a necessary but insufficient condition for successful learning; a number of strategies are proposed to support understanding.
